The OP came in here looking for a fight as far as I could tell. I don't mind a person putting a fixed gear rear wheel on a bike, done it myself. Most of the people that post in here are interested in bike history and preservation.
Fixie conversion of an actual classic/vintage bike is not going to be looked kindly on in here depending on the amount of hacking and painting that that entails. It seems like the worst excesses of fixie conversions are past, people don't spraybomb their '58 Cinellis quite as often.
